Transaction ba29632c53564543d32f697eda0ef826daeb79da9cac8e5fa84a18c34316cc74
1 Input
1 Output
-
ba29632c53564543d32f697eda0ef826daeb79da9cac8e5fa84a18c34316cc74:0
- value
- 4588116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c561bb31a57236c82a03b7b939ac57920f3862d9 OP_EQUAL
- address
- 3Kgg7pTMJQ37YxVY7mZUMYgaBabHUyVLP9